Transaction 28e529f22c94a88dff3308b428fba2269c262ec94824b716f331e35912f3bbf5
1 Input
1 Output
-
28e529f22c94a88dff3308b428fba2269c262ec94824b716f331e35912f3bbf5:0
- value
- 1976379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75039f6c9bb09bcbc5e69f40d0a0103c89df7714 OP_EQUAL
- address
- 3CMjKhcdcKtd44vcvJE1z11fbiJAEu2R7j